Company Name: Tenet Healthcare Corporation - HOU
Job Title: HRIS Customer Service Specialist
Location: Dallas, TX
Profession: HRIS Analysis/Support

Job Description:

Tenet, through its subsidiaries, owns and operates acute care hospitals and numerous related health care services. Our mission is to be recognized for our commitment to our people and partners who provide quality, innovative care to the patients we serve in our communities. It's a spirit you can experience first-hand and it's a philosophy that can enhance your own approach to health care and your career goals.



Description


HRIS support role will encompass technical skills and customer service skills


. Activities include recognition, research,

 


isolation of issues and follow-up to resolution in support of HRIS applications. Duties will include but are not limited to:



* Utilize available technology to support training and development of HRIS applications (HealthStream, Taleo,



 


SuccessFactors; others as assigned) Experience with application(s) a plus.



* Work closely with individual hospital Admins and leaders to resolve issues with functionality of HRIS applications


* Create corporate level and hospital level reports as required for all applications



Provide support and training of features and functionality for all applications



* Share education and training best practices


* Work as liaison between Tenet and HealthStream support teams at corporate level



Troubleshoot software and hardware to ensure basic requirements are met



* Manage and edit distribution lists


* Support other team members as required



Candidate must have a strong work ethic, teamwork capabilities, excellent multi-tasking skills, excellent written and oral



 


communication skills, experience working directly with customers, project management experience a plus. Candidate must also be able to work independently and efficiently with minimal supervision.



Qualifications


 



Minimum of 2-3 years customer service experience



* Degree in Computer Science, MIS degree preferred but not required


* Minimum of two years experience in a technical support role


* Incident management a plus (Customer service/phone etiquette)


* Possess good organizational skills and 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ks


* Proficient to expert using MicroSoft suite of products (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Project, Access)

This profession covers individuals who are involved with compensation issues and benefits administration. This includes individuals who put benefits packages together and administer them to employees, as well as those who calculate compensation plans.
This profession covers individuals who have management or oversight responsibilities within the HR function. The individual may also have oversight responsibilities for multiple functions.
This profession covers individuals who support the other members of the HR department by doing business data analysis or helping with HR application-level system support. These individuals work with commercial or homegrown HRIS systems
This profession covers individuals who are tasked with handling a variety of HR functions within an organization. Issues include recruiting, compensation, benefits, organizational development and employee relations.
This profession covers individuals who are involved in the development of an organization’s policies and procedures. This includes preparing succession plans, drafting employee manuals/policies and conducting training programs.
This profession covers individuals who are involved with the recruiting/staffing functions within an organization. Contingent/retained recruiters are not well covered by this profession.
